Cetrimonium bromide (CTAB) is a cationic surfactant with antimicrobial and hair-conditioning effects. Useful at low % in rinse-off but irritating in concentrate.

Skin benefits

  • Cationic surfactant and conditioner
  • Antimicrobial preservative
  • Improves wet combability of hair

Known concerns

  • Eye and skin irritant in concentrate
  • EU restricts use levels
  • Avoid leave-on at high %
